Understanding the Basics of Sauerkraut and Water Bath Canning
Before diving into the specifics of water bath duration, it’s essential to understand what sauerkraut is and the basic principles behind water bath canning. Sauerkraut is a fermented cabbage dish that has been a staple in many cuisines, particularly in European cooking, for centuries. It’s made by shredding cabbage, salting it to draw out its natural moisture, and then allowing it to ferment in its own juice. This fermentation process creates lactic acid, which acts as a natural preservative, giving sauerkraut its distinctive sour taste and long shelf life.
Water bath canning, on the other hand, is a method used to preserve foods by heating them to a high temperature, typically in aLarge pot filled with boiling water, to kill off bacteria and create a seal. This method is particularly effective for high-acid foods like sauerkraut, jams, and pickles, as the acidity acts as an additional barrier against bacterial growth.
The Role of Acidity in Sauerkraut Preservation
Sauerkraut’s natural acidity plays a crucial role in its preservation. The fermentation process, as mentioned, produces lactic acid, which maintains the sauerkraut’s pH level at an acidic range, typically below 4.6. This acidity, combined with the heat from the water bath, ensures that the sauerkraut is adequately preserved against common pathogens like Clostridium botulinum, the bacteria responsible for botulism.

Guidelines for Water Bathing Sauerkraut
Given these factors, here are some general guidelines for water bathing sauerkraut:
General Processing Times
For most locations at or below 1,000 feet in altitude, the following processing times are recommended for sauerkraut packed in pint jars:
– 10 minutes for hot-packed sauerkraut (where the sauerkraut is heated before packing into jars).
– 20 minutes for raw-packed sauerkraut (where the sauerkraut is packed into jars without preheating).
For altitudes above 1,000 feet, it’s necessary to adjust these times based on the specific altitude. A general rule of thumb is to increase the processing time by 1 minute for every 1,000 feet of altitude.

How do I store fermented sauerkraut to maintain its quality and freshness?
Storing fermented sauerkraut requires careful attention to maintain its quality and freshness. Once the sauerkraut has reached the desired level of fermentation, you can remove it from the water bath and transfer it to a container with a tight-fitting lid, such as a glass jar or a ceramic container. It’s essential to press down on the sauerkraut to remove any air pockets and create a tight, even layer, before covering it with a lid or plastic wrap. The sauerkraut should then be stored in the refrigerator at a temperature below 40°F (4°C) to slow down the fermentation process.
By storing the sauerkraut in the refrigerator, you can slow down the fermentation process and maintain its quality and freshness for several months. It’s essential to check the sauerkraut regularly for any signs of spoilage, such as mold, yeast, or an off smell, and to remove any affected areas immediately. You can also freeze the sauerkraut to extend its shelf life, but be aware that freezing can affect the texture and flavor of the sauerkraut. By following these storage tips, you can enjoy your fermented sauerkraut for a longer period and maintain its delicious flavor and crunchy texture.
